
Pyridostigmine (60mg)
Active composition
Pyridostigmine inhibits acetylcholinesterase, increasing acetylcholine levels at the neuromuscular junction and enhancing muscle contraction.
Medical applications
Mustone 60mg Tablet contains Pyridostigmine, a cholinesterase inhibitor, as its active ingredient. It is primarily used in the management of myasthenia gravis, a neuromuscular disorder characterized by muscle weakness and fatigue. Pyridostigmine works by preventing the breakdown of acetylcholine, a neurotransmitter, thereby enhancing the transmission of nerve impulses at the neuromuscular junction, which helps to improve muscle strength. This medication should be taken as directed by a healthcare professional, and any questions regarding its use should be discussed with a healthcare provider. It is important to note that Mustone 60mg Tablet may cause side effects such as abdominal cramps, diarrhea, and sweating. Regular monitoring by a healthcare professional is recommended to ensure safe and effective use of this medication.
